Call for action on integrity test for houses, especially those under construction is on the lips of Nigerians as another building collapsed in Ibadan..though no life was lost and Gov. Ajimobi has orders free treatment at government hospital..
Fridays building collapse in Ibadan came barely 72 hours after a similar incident in Lagos, in which no fewer than 20 persons, including school children, died.
The collapse of the Lagos building, housing a school and other businesses, also left many injured.
The three-storey building, which is still under construction, had collapsed on Friday evening at the Shogoye area of the city, leaving some persons injured.
The governor directed that the victims should be moved to the state hospitals and should be given immediate treatment at no cost to them.
Ajimobi expressed sadness over the incident, which he described as avoidable.
He expressed gratitude to God that no life was lost in the incident.
